I just purchased a Phantom 2 and Zenmuse Gimbal H3-2D. I have all the latest firmware for Main Controller(1.08), Receiver-Phantom 2(1.0.0.0), P330CB(1.0.1.19), Gimbal CMU(1.0), Gimbal IMU(1.8).
My first question is regarding the picture I have attached here, do I have the Gimbal mounted correctly onto the Phantom 2? I finally saw a video that has the "updated" mount and it appears I should move it back to be more centered on the base?
Second question: Do I need to take any steps or configure anything in Naza M mode of the Assistant Software before 1st flight? Is the phantom automatically in GPS mode out of the box, do I have to actually "turn it on"
Issue I am having with Gimbal tilt control with X1: When I first installed the Gimbal, the tilt lever control on the back of the D6 controller was tilting the Gimbal beautifully, slow and easy. Now, when I move the tilt lever it shoots the gimbal angle from one extreme to the other, there's no stop in between. I have tried adjusting the Manual Control speed, Servo travel limit pitch, etc. No changes happen when i adjust any of these things.
